Someone Is Always Watching by Kelley Armstrong

I am a huge Kelley Armstrong fan and I have read a ton of her books, meet her in person and obnoxiously had her sign basically every book she had written at that point. Unfortunately, Someone is Always Watching was not a hit for me. It wasn’t bad, I’ve just read so many mystery thrillers that not much surprises me anymore and this twist was found out relatively soon. So no real big twist for the reader. This was a bit more “sci-fi” than I usually look even though it’s not pitched that way. A I-fi is my least fave genre. 
As for characters, personally there were too many for me. I could remember who was who especially when Blythe was also called Bliss, not really close so it was confusing, at least for me. I kind of felt bad for the characters, but they aren’t ones that I cared too much about.
I’d maybe recommend this to true YA readers who are just starting out with mystery thrillers.
